U.S. House of Representatives Sept 13, 2006
(Text from the Congressional Record)
The [Guest Chaplain] Reverend Louis V. Iasiello, President, Washington Theological Union, Washington, DC, offered the
following prayer:
Most good and gracious God, You bless us and guide us at every moment of our lives, and most especially at times of great
trial and adversity.
We thank You for the priceless gift of this great Nation and for the constitutional principles that guide it. We thank Thee for
the many liberties that mark us as a blessed and a free people, and for myriad patriots who have worn the sacred cloth of military service throughout our proud
history, citizen warriors who have defended those freedoms against the tyrannies of days past and those who continue the good fight this very day. We know their
service honors You, for it stands as yet one more sign of the great bounty that is the United States of America.
And so at this troublesome time of national emergency, in the current struggle against global extremism, we ask for the
strength to face adversity with pure and sincere hearts that You might empower us to be a light for all the nations and build a world with justice and peace for men
and women of good will everywhere. So help us God, amen.
